Has anyone ever cut a "window" on the side of one of those opaque plastic bins commonly used for snakes?

I am thinking of using a sheet of clear acrylic I have 15 by 8 on side of 30 inch by 14 inch high plastic bin and siliconing it from the inside as a window which allows better view but not sure if bin will hold shape.

I had planned to cut the window with sharp box cutter .
